OSN3500 SSN1EMS4 Single Board Configuration BPS Protection Reporting ETH_LOS Alarms

Problem description

After the OSN3500 SSN1EMS4 single board is configured with BPS protection using the FE electrical ports, it is found that the ports of the standby single board have been reporting ETH_LOS alarms, and when forcible inversion is performed, it is possible to successfully invert the ports, but after disconnecting the network cable of the primary channel, the inversion cannot be performed successfully.

The host version is R8.

Alarm information

ETH_LOS

Processing

1. Check that the port operating mode of the primary single board is 100MFULL, because for 100M electrical ports, only 100MFULLBPS protection is supported.

2, BPS protection is divided into master mode and slave mode, in the case of BPS master mode, the standby port of the single board is shutting down the transmission, resulting in the opposite end of the LINK_ERR or ETH_LOS state, but the opposite end of the standby port will not shut down the transmission, which ensures that the master and standby ports are LINK_UP state, and the master and standby boards are all in a usable state.

InBPS slave mode, the backup port of the single board will not shut down the transmission, and it is always in the open state, and when the reversal occurs, the main port of the single board will be closed for 3 seconds and then opened again.

4. After confirming that the BSC of our C-network is docked, in the R8 version of the OSN equipment, the BPS of the FE electrical port only supports the BPS master mode of 100MFULL, and in this mode, the backup port is always in the state of shutting down, which results in the port of the docked BSC equipment reporting the ETH_LOS alarm, and the BSC equipment will shut down its own transmission when it receives the LOS alarm, resulting in the backup port on the transmission equipment always shutting down its transmission, and the backup port on the transmission equipment is always in the state of shutting down transmission. When the BSC device receives the LOS alarm, the BSC device also shuts down its own transmission, resulting in an ETH_LOS alarm being reported on the backup port of the transmission device, and the single board remains in an unavailable state.

Upgrade to version V1R9C04 to support the slave mode of FE port to solve the problem.

Root cause

1、Docking device problem

2、Setting problem

3、Version problem

Suggestions and Summary

The problem exists with our C-netBSC docking, for docking with other manufacturers' equipment, it can also be handled along the above lines.
